While most robots have sensors that aid in navigation the environment, the top models have superior spatial awareness. Premium Roomba models can, for instance, recognize stairs and stairways.

They also come with Smart Maps that allow them to efficiently move from room to rooms. Other models, for instance our budget pick Eufy 11s, utilize random "bump-and-run" navigation.

The iRobot Roomba 750 Plus and 850 use what iRobot calls Smart Mapping technology, which uses multiple sensors to identify your home and avoid objects. The sensors scan for staircases and walls as well as furniture cords, legs and other items that can cause the robot to get stuck. With the help of millions of customer data, the mapping technology of iRobot improves with time and becomes more efficient at avoiding obstacles.

In contrast, our budget option, the Eufy 11S, does not include smart mapping and has bounce or random navigation. It'll run in a straight-line until it hits an obstacle, then spend a significant amount of time trying to navigate it. It's also not very good at navigating corners and other tight spaces, and the software that creates its paths is inconsistent. The robot doesn't work with Alexa or Google Assistant.
